The Importance of Effective Grain Storage Management in Modern Farming

Proper management of stored grain is a critical component of successful farming operations. Grain bins serve as the final step in the agribusiness process, where harvested crops are stored until they reach the market or are prepared for further processing. Without adequate monitoring, farmers face challenges such as moisture accumulation, mold growth, insect infestations, and spoilage—all of which lead to significant financial losses.

Traditional grain storage management relies heavily on manual inspections and estimation, which are labor-intensive, inconsistent, and often fail to detect issues promptly. This reactive approach can result in unexpected spoilage, reduced grain quality, and increased operational costs. Therefore, employing a proactive, technology-driven solution like grain bin monitoring becomes essential for modern farmers aiming to maximize yields, protect their investments, and streamline their workflows.

What Is Grain Bin Monitoring?

Grain bin monitoring refers to the use of integrated sensors, data analytics, and remote monitoring technology to oversee the conditions inside farm storage bins in real time. These systems continuously track key parameters such as temperature, humidity, oxygen levels, and grain movement, providing farmers with instant insights into the state of their stored crops.

Modern grain bin monitoring solutions are often connected via IoT (Internet of Things) devices, enabling farmers to access critical data through smartphones, tablets, or computers. This connectivity facilitates timely interventions, improving grain quality and reducing losses without the need for frequent, manual inspections.

Key Components of a Modern Grain Bin Monitoring System

  • Sensors: Measure environmental parameters like temperature, humidity, oxygen levels, and moisture content.
  • Data Transmission Devices: Wireless modules or wired systems that relay sensor data to cloud servers or local monitors.
  • Software Platform: User-friendly interfaces that display real-time data, send alerts, and generate reports for analysis.
  • Alert Systems: Customized notifications via email or SMS to inform farmers of potential issues immediately.
  • Integration Capabilities: Compatibility with existing farm management software and equipment for seamless operation.

Benefits of Implementing Grain Bin Monitoring in Your Farming Operations

1. Enhanced Grain Quality and Preservation

Continuous monitoring helps maintain optimal conditions inside the storage bin, preventing spoilage caused by moisture buildup and temperature fluctuations. Early detection of problematic conditions ensures timely corrective actions, preserving grain integrity and maximizing market value.

2. Reduction of Post-Harvest Losses

According to agricultural studies, post-harvest losses can account for up to 20% of stored grain. Grain bin monitoring systems significantly reduce these losses by providing farmers with real-time data, allowing for swift responses to issues like pest infestations or moisture problems before they escalate.

3. Improved Operational Efficiency

Instead of manual inspections, farmers can rely on automated data collection to make informed decisions. This automation saves time and labor, enabling staff to focus on other critical farming activities, and supports more strategic planning.

4. Cost Savings and Increased Profitability

By preventing spoilage and reducing labor costs associated with manual inspections, grain bin monitoring systems contribute directly to higher profit margins. Additionally, early detection of issues minimizes the need for costly remediation measures.

5. Data-Driven Decision Making

Access to precise, real-time data empowers farmers to optimize storage conditions, plan for future harvests, and improve overall farm management strategies. Historical data analysis also helps in identifying patterns and improving storage practices over time.

Choosing the Right Grain Bin Monitoring System for Your Farm

Selecting the appropriate grain bin monitoring system depends on several factors including the size of your storage facilities, the type of crops stored, environmental conditions, and budget considerations. Here are some critical aspects to consider:

  • Sensor Accuracy and Reliability: Ensure sensors are precise and durable enough for harsh farm environments.
  • Remote Access and Alerts: Opt for systems that provide real-time notifications via mobile devices or computers.
  • Integration Capabilities: Compatibility with existing farm management tools and equipment is vital for streamlined operations.
  • Ease of Installation and Maintenance: Systems should be straightforward to install and maintain without extensive downtime.
  • Customer Support and Warranty: Reliable support services and warranty options add value and confidence to your investment.

Future Trends in Grain Storage and Monitoring Technology

As technology advances, grain bin monitoring systems will become even more sophisticated, integrating artificial intelligence (AI), machine learning, and predictive analytics to forecast storage issues before they occur. These innovations promise higher levels of automation, predictive maintenance, and enhanced data accuracy, further transforming farm management practices.

Additionally, the increased adoption of cloud-based platforms will facilitate centralized management of multiple storage facilities across large-scale farms, simplifying oversight and decision-making.
